Assertion (A) All noble gases are monoatomic.
Reason (R) All noble gases have very low melting and boiling points.
- A Both \(\mathrm{A}\) and \(\mathrm{R}\) are correct and \(\mathrm{R}\) is the correct explanation of \(A\).
- B Both \(\mathrm{A}\) and \(\mathrm{R}\) are correct but \(\mathrm{R}\) is not the correct explanation of \(A\).
- C \(\mathrm{A}\) is correct but \(\mathrm{R}\) is incorrect.
- D \(\mathrm{A}\) is incorrect but \(\mathrm{R}\) is correct.
Answer & Solution
Correct Answer
(B) Both \(\mathrm{A}\) and \(\mathrm{R}\) are correct but \(\mathrm{R}\) is not the correct explanation of \(A\).
Step-by-step Solution
Detailed explanation
All noble gases have completely filled valence shell. So, they do not form bonds with any other atom and hence they are always monoatomic. Since, the noble gases have weak interatomic force, they have very low melting and boiling points. Hence, Both (A) and (R) are correct but…
